Mallorca Bowling
Mallorca Bowling is a bowling centre in Palma on Camí dels Reis, 211. The venue has 14 lanes and is described as the island’s only ten-pin bowling hall; prices mentioned include €8 to €9.50 per game and €39.90 for a children’s package with one game, a starter, a drink and a main course. Bowling is usually walk-in only, and waits of 40 minutes to 2–3 hours are reported. Extra options include arcade machines, pool, karaoke and other games.

Do I need to book in advance at Mallorca Bowling in Palma, or can I just turn up?
According to several reviews, it is not always possible to reserve a bowling lane. If the lanes are full, waiting times can range from 40 minutes to 2–3 hours, especially on Friday to Sunday evenings and on public holidays. For Mallorca Bowling, it is therefore worth arriving early or calling +34 971 25 40 88.

How much does bowling at Mallorca Bowling cost roughly?
Reviews mention around €8 to €9.50 per game. One example states €19 for 2 children including shoe hire and about half an hour of bowling, while another mentions €60 for 3 games for 3 people. A children’s package is also referenced at €39.90 for two children, including a game, starter, drink and main course.
Are there other activities at Mallorca Bowling besides bowling?
Yes, several reviews mention additional activities such as arcade games, pool, air hockey, table football, darts, table shuffleboard and karaoke. Arcade machines are often quoted at around €2 per play, and some machines require €1 coins. This makes it possible to pass the waiting time even when no lane is available.

Where is Mallorca Bowling located in Palma, and is there parking?
Mallorca Bowling is in Palma, near Son Moix; one review also says it is fairly close to Palma Nova by car. Reviews mention nearby bus stops, so it can also be reached by public transport. Parking is described as limited by some visitors, so arriving early is a practical option.
Is Mallorca Bowling wheelchair accessible, and what is the indoor climate like?
One review mentions a wheelchair ramp, a wheelchair lift and an accessible toilet with a changing table. Several guests also note that it can be very warm in summer and rather cool in winter. If you are sensitive to temperature, visiting outside the hottest hours is often more comfortable.
